My family of 5 (1 is still in a stroller) will be going to Disney in a little less than two weeks. We'll be staying at a family suite in the All Star Music Resort. I booked the AAA so I have their parking pass.

Do you think it would be more convenient to ride the bus system or to drive and use the AAA parking pass?

IMHO, considering you have a stroller, it may be easier and quicker to drive your family rather than taking the busses if you plan on staying for evening fireworks and have to face a mass exodus from the parks. Obviously, folks are tired and cranky and sometimes there is a long wait for the return busses and standing room only etc. Otherwise, during the day and off times, the bus waits are usually short and not crowded so it would be perfect to take advantage of them then.
Personally, when we arrive at WDW, I put my car keys away and use the Disney Transportation System entirely, but I have older kids.

Except it is almost ALWAYS more advisable to use Disney transportation to and from the Magic Kingdom. The bus drops you only a few hundred feet from the park entrance.
If you drive yourselves, you'd need to park in the AAA area (assuming there are spaces available, then walk under the access road to the TTC, then wait for a monorail (lines could be long and you may not get on the first one) or board the ferry and wait for it to fill and depart.

AAA parking may get you a little closer to a given park entrance, but I'd still stick with WDW transportation for getting to and from parks. We've stayed at AllStar Music twice for 7 days each and AllStar Movie for one short stay and we've found AllStar bus service to be the best of all the WDW resorts we've stayed at, including POR, Swan and Dolphin. A folding stroller is no problem. I'd only use a car if going to a resort from AllStar as busses don't run between resorts. I'm not a public transportation sort of guy, I like to have my own wheels handy, but 8 trips to WDW resorts have convinced me to Take the Bus, Gus.

If you are planning to get to the parks before opening, we have found that driving to AK, TL, and BB is very easy and efficient. I've heard MGM is pretty good, too. If you plan to arrive late, know that the AAA spots can fill up, and that if they do, you could be parking so far from the front entrance that you'll wish you had taken the bus! We never drive anywhere for our evening touring of one of the parks, but early morning it's much easier than taking the bus.
